There are 7 on campus libraries and one in Shady
Grove. McKeldin Library has 1 million volumes and was once the backup to the Library of
Congress.

It is a tradition that undergraduates swim in the Omicron Delta Kappa fountain at least once before they graduate. If
you’re inducted into ODK, you will have your name
engraved around the fountain.

TRIVIA:“Testudo,” the name of
our mascot, is actually a taxonomic classification of
turtles. Students rub Testudo’s nose for
good luck!
